Consumers are now taking control of their own home deliveries as ‘Where’s my parcel?’ calls have reportedly declined by 10 per cent.
Within six months, 250,000 customers have signed up to Aramex’s new self-service delivery portal – this comes after the logistics freight and courier service met the demands of e-commerce businesses and parcel recipients through aramexConnect.
The application is reported to offer an easy to use, online self-service portal that streamlines sending and receiving parcels, allowing users to access photo-proof delivery, print labels, track deliveries and more.
Through this new advancement the 10 per cent drop in customer service inquiries has meant customers readily have the tools to find their own answers.
“Customers want fewer unknowns and more control without having to pick up the phone,” said Aramex Regional Director, Mark Little.
The transparent application offers real-time control and helps keep recipients informed, while allowing logistics teams to focus on moving parcels as opposed to managing customer expectations.
